We won our flight at the member/guest at the PGA Village. 21 flights in total. The playoff was 10 teams go to #1 and 11 teams go to #10. We went to 10. Format is alternate shot with 4 teams advancing to the next hole. Tie breaker is a chip off. It was quite a sight. In addition to the 11 teams there were maybe another 25 groups following in their carts.

We drew #7 to tee off. Some great drives and some ugly drives prior to my partner. He gets up and tops it 40 to 50 yards into the junk and after about 50 of us took the 3 minutes to find the ball it was declared lost. I had to tee it up again in front of the crowd. Thank goodness I got it in the fairway about 220 yards. Left him with about 140 and he hit it 120. I chipped on and left him about a 40 footer. We picked up but had a great time.

Played Pinehurst #4 today and shot a hard battled 74....with 4 birds. The early season looseness in my swing continues but I somehow seem to bounce back and keep it in control. Hoping this trend continues and I have a better season than last year. On a related note #4 was my favorite that we played in this trip. A bit tougher off the tee than #2 but the greens are a bit more friendly. Good approach shots are just hurt and not punished like on #2.

For all of you who have forgotten the joys of being a rusty in need of practice high capper:

Finally got to play a post work 9 yesterday and proceeded to have the most Jekyll and Hyde 9 holes to ever exist. 

There was a high school golf match on the front, and another team practicing on the back, so I was sent off #14.  I'm racing to beat the sun and keep a good pace so the cart behind me that started on 13 doesn't catch up.  Shank my tee shot off of the toe.  Proceed to hit a miracle 7 iron onto the green and par the first hole.  Trouble off the tee on 15, waste a shot and shoot a double (6).  Par 3 16, pull a four iron right of the green, pitch releases, bogey.  My nemesis holes 17 and 18, par 4/5 are next.  Blow those up with an 8 and 9.    Up next the easiest hole on the course, par 3 #10--draw an 8 iron just off the green, up and down for par.   Par four #11, First good drive all day--Nice 277 yd fade that ends up just off fairway.  Chunky wedge, up and down for par.   #12 Pull hook with the 5 wood, puts me in some trouble, clean up with an 8 iron and a save with the ER2 for par.  Then the longest hole on the track Par 5 #13. Playing 540 verified by Shotscope.  A storm is starting to roll in. Hit the only my second good drive all day, beautiful fade into about a 20 mph headwind, a paltry 223.  Then the problems come back.  Fat the next two 3 woods, followed by a duck hook 7 iron 40 yards right of the green.  Lots of wedges, a couple of failed flop shots and a bunker later: finish the day with an 11.  

Lots of toe side of center ball striking and great lag putting.

TLDR:  53, with 4 pars and 16 putts. 4 holes double or worse.

Moral of the story:  I love this game and I am in dire need of practice.  Project #breakingbogey has begun!
